Here are some
techniques you can start using today:
1. Use
affirmations to boost your self-esteem. On the back of a business
card or small index card, write a statement such as ‘I like and
accept myself just the way I am’ or ‘I am the master of my destiny’,
‘I am somebody, I love myself, I believe in myself’. Carry the card
with you. Repeat the words several times during the day, especially
at night before going to bed and upon getting up in the
morning. Whenever you repeat the affirmation, allow yourself to
experience positive feelings about the statement.
2. Associate with positive, supportive people. When you are
surrounded by negative people who constantly put you and your ideas
down, your self-esteem is bound to take a hit. On the other hand,
when you are accepted and encouraged, you feel better about yourself
and are in the best possible environment to raise your self-esteem.
3. Make a list of your successes. This doesn't have to consist of
monumental accomplishments. It can include such ‘minor victories’
as learning to skate, graduating from high school or college, or
receiving an award or promotion. Read this list often. While
reviewing it, close your eyes and relive the feelings of
satisfaction and joy you experienced when you first attained each
success.
